The original infobox gave the impression that Cobden was from and of Sussex and London. The text celebrated his work in Manchester. But his political career representing Stockport, Rochdale, and West Yorkshire was largely missing. So I added that. And now people will know more.pic.twitter.com/hv7pfXR8Dw
